Gene delivery mediated by liposome-DNA complex with cleavable PEG surface modification

A liposome composition and method for delivery of a nucleic acid in vivo or ex vivo is described. The liposomes in the composition are comprised of (i) a cationic lipid and (ii) a lipid joined to a hydrophilic polymer by a releasable linkage. The liposomes are associated with a nucleic acid for delivery to a cell.
Liposome composition for delivery of nucleic acid

A liposome composition for delivery of a nucleic acid in vivo or ex vivo is described. The liposomes in the composition are comprised of (i) a lipid that is neutral in charge at physiologic pH and positively charged at pH values less than physiologic pH and (ii) a lipid joined to a hydrophilic polymer by a dithiobenzyl linkage. The liposomes are associated with a nucleic acid for delievery to a cell.
Releasable linkage and compositions containing same

A compound comprised of a hydrophilic polymer covalently yet reversibly linked to a amine-containing ligand through a dithiobenzyl linkage is described.
Process for producing cysteamines and/or cystamines

Specific cysteamines and/or cystamines are produced by a process which comprises causing (A) an aminoalkyl sulfate ester and (B) hydrogen sulfide and an alkali polysulfide formed from an alkali hydrogen sulfide and sulfur to react.
